### Changelog — Gridsmith 2.4.1

Hey, quick note for the new folks: we rotated the signing key for the Gridsmith crossword generator this week. Old builds will still verify until month's end, then the verifier goes strict. Puzzle output is unchanged — clue packing, symmetry checks, all the same. Just re-sign any local builds before pushing. New builds should be signed with the key below.

rollout seal: bky9_aBG1gvAyU

Subject: Template cut-over complete

Team — the Quenchly renderer cut-over finished last night. Median render time dropped from 180ms to 40ms; the old engine is retired. Support: cached fragments may look stale for up to an hour. Escalate only reproducible blank-page reports. The renderer now runs with the following configuration.

config for yawig-yawip:
[framir]
host = framir.lumiccorp.internal
user = framir_svc
database = framir_prod

### Step 4: Rebuild the Quickfind index

The legacy Quickfind autocomplete index is slow because prefix shards were never split. This step rebuilds it with four-way sharding. Note for review: the rebuild job runs with read-only credentials and writes only to the new index namespace; the old index stays untouched until step 6. No data leaves the Harlowe cluster. The job reads its runtime settings from the block below.

config for kajog-tadug:
[casax]
port = 11211
region = west-3
host = casax.nelvroworks.internal
timeout_ms = 5000
retries = 7

## Authentication

Plugins that ship telemetry to the Gravelock collector must gzip payloads over 4 KB and set the matching content-encoding header; uncompressed oversized batches are rejected with a 413. Each request also requires a bearer credential scoped to your plugin's namespace. For local development against the Fennway sandbox collector, authenticate your requests with the token below.

session JWT of yawep-yawep = eyJhbGciOiJIUzI1NiIsInR5cCI6IkpXVCJ9.eyJzdWIiOiI3pWF3_In0.aXYsHiog